This internship provides hands-on experience with the Mammals and Birds team, working directly with trainers to support the daily care of species including Beluga whales, Harbor seals, Asian small-clawed otters, Binturongs, Sea otters, African penguins, and Alcids. Interns are paired with a mentor and participate in training seminars to learn operant conditioning principles and their application in a professional zoo setting.
What you'll do#
- Assist with daily animal diet preparation and commissary clean-up.
- Conduct behavioral observations and perform data recording and entry.
- Support environmental enrichment and habitat maintenance, including water sampling.
- Assist the training team during husbandry sessions, animal handling, and medical procedures.
